The combined paid circulation of American daily newspapers has fallen from more than 63 million in 1984 to less than 50 million today — a drop of 21 percent during a time when the number of households grew by about 40 percent.

U.S. Daily newspapers today have less than

14 percent of total U.S. advertising expenditures. In 1989 it was 28 percent — so they’ve lost half their market share in 20 years.

Source: Martin C. Langeveld

Page 7: Lead Type, Dead Type: New patterns of local news production and consumption

More than 30,000 newspaper employees have lost their jobs since 2007

Q2-2009: Ad revenue fell 29 percent to $6.82 billion from $9.6 billion a year earlier

Major papers have ceased printing, or declared bankruptcy

80 percent-plus declines in market capitalization for major chains

How are news consumption practices changing with the shift from print to digital on the ground?

If the demand for local news is high, why is business bad?

What are the strategic, instrumental and technical design opportunities for transforming and encouraging local news readership and production participation?

Page 17: Lead Type, Dead Type: New patterns of local news production and consumption

Field-based interview study

Analyzed content of three local papers

Semi-structured interviews with Bay Area residents

Interviews with 2 journalists, 2 bloggers, and 2 local news blog sites

Panel with local journalists

Routines First thing I do every morning is I grab my iPhone

and I look up the news, the AP news application.

Snacking I take breaks all day and check the news…I am

online pretty much all day.

Paper There is something very satisfying about reading

something on paper. It is much easier on the eyes and on the senses. Reading a newspaper is not like the tunnel vision of reading online.

Page 21: Lead Type, Dead Type: New patterns of local news production and consumption

Aesthetics The [San Francisco] Chronicle has never been as

poorly written as it is now.

Credibility With a blog I feel like I have to evaluate every

single one to decide whether to believe the content or not. They are not necessarily trusted sources.

Findability You know I typed in “News today Noe Valley” and

what I got back was just a lot of stuff from months to years back. I mean how hard is it to return something with today’s news? What is so hard about understanding what “today” means?
